select语句执行的结果是什么

品牌型号:华为MateBook D15

系统:Windows 11

select语句执行的结果是表。select语句目的,就是从数据库检索,统计输出数据。select 语句的执行过程,根据查询内容数据,组成一个结果集,然后用表的形式返回。所以执行结果是一张表。

select语句的执行流程:

1、通过客户端/服务器通信协议与MysqL建立连接。

2、查询缓存,这是 MysqL一个可优化查询的地方,如果开启了Query Cache且在查询缓存过程中查询到完全相同的sql语句,则将查询结果直接返回给客户端;如果没有开启Query Cache或者没有查询到完全相同的sql语句则会由解析器进行语法语义解析,并生成解析树。

3、预处理器生成新的解析树。

4、查询优化器生成执行计划。

5、查询执行引擎执行sql语句,此时查询执行引擎会根据sql语句中表的存储引擎类型,以及对应的API接口与底层存储引擎缓存或者物理文件的交互情况,得到查询结果,由MysqL Server过滤后将查询结果缓存并返回给客户端。若开启了Query Cache,这时也会将sql语句和结果完整地保存到Query Cache中,以后若有相同的sql语句执行则直接返回结果。

相关文章

7月21日消息,微软今天通过官方微信公众号宣布,国行Xbox Se...
冰箱外边两侧很烫没有危险。这是由冰箱的制冷原理决定的,蒸...
1、鼠标设置有的灵敏度比较高,可以降低一下其灵敏度(降低双击...
1、光猫本身接口出现故障,造成无法接收光信号可以更换光猫。...
空调内机出风口冒白烟原因:1、制冷强烈,制冷温度低。2、房...
空调显示f1请不要继续使用。出现F1错误代码表示空调高压开关...